Output eacfa9e7588301d030215179cbb72ac2510b61574efe80619363900b658fa0aa:1

value
25058
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e3878b5fd59f801ed6e58465a509bbac9d6da5a OP_EQUAL
address
3AHD6HZLkGKz7BPKw1rhujGVenLaDnfV5x
transaction
eacfa9e7588301d030215179cbb72ac2510b61574efe80619363900b658fa0aa
spent
true